Voting Begins for Celebrated Service Award

It's one of the most coveted awards in the region, In fact, it's the world's largest service prize, and there are now ten local business enterprises ready for the week long battle for the badge of honor that is the Celebration! Cinema Celebrated Service Award. Those ten companies now face off in the public vote with anticipation of thousands of votes due to be cast through cell phone texting.

Emily Loeks from Celebration! Cinema says public voting begins today, Wednesday, November 2nd and runs through next Thursday, November 10th with the award winners to be announced at noon on Friday, November 11th. 

The Celebrated Service Award has three key goals. One is to use the power of storytelling as a teaching and training tool for Celebration! Cinema employees, who advocate for business finalists based on direct experiences that have inspired them. Secondly, the campaign aspires to be an encouragement to all business nominees, each of who receive promotion, movie perks and an invitation to an annual "Art of Celebrated Service" workshop, Finally, Celebration! Cinema hopes that the campaign can be one factor contributing to people's expectation that this is a region of the country marked by world-class hospitality.

The Celebrated Service Award is supported by sponsors Beene Garter LLP, Fifth Third Bank, MLive Media Group and Zingerman's Community of Businesses. John Zimmerman of Fifth Third says his company supports the award "Because it focuses on people who are taking care of their customers." 

Jamie Dionne of MLive says, "You could have the smallest exchange with somebody at a coffee shop and it literally could make your day. Those moments can be few and far between, but you always remember them."

Business winners of the Celebrated Service Award in each Michigan region earn a full year of recognition on the Celebration! Cinema movie screens, in lobbies, on the website, through Facebook and on radio. The award also includes a $5,000 cash prize, specialized ZingTrain training in Ann Arbor, and movie watch parties for the employees of the business recipient. 

Past award recipients have appreciated all of the encouragement that they have received from their customers and reported that the recognition has contributed to the health of their businesses. By way of example, 2015 Award winners Bob Evans of Benton Harbor's Bryan Long says, "When someone walks into Bob Evans and they are known by name they smile. We want to treat strangers like friends, and friends like family."

One business will win a Celebrated Service Award in each of the six markets where Celebration! Cinema theatres operate. The value of the award packages for the six regional recipients totals more than $360,000. 

As Tom Rosenbach from sponsor Beene Garter points out, "Celebrated Service helps create the culture of West Michigan. I think that people want to come here because they know this culture exists, and they are attracted to it."
